学生成绩信息表
⑴ (1/2)写出在学生成绩信息表(studscoreinfo)和学生信息表(studinfo)查询性别为女的所有学生成绩记录。(...
select *
from studscoreinfo
where studno in(select studno
from studinfo
where studsex=’女’)
⑵ c语言编程,输入学生成绩记录表重的信息。再按从高到低的排序输出,并计算总分
#include<stdio.h>
structStudent{
intnum;
charname[10];
intgrade;
};
voidmain(){
voidinput(structStudentstu[],intn);//函数声明//
voidorder(structStudentstu[],intn);
intsum(structStudentstu[],intn);
structStudentstu[10];
input(stu,10);
order(stu,10);
printf("Sum=%d ",sum(stu,10));
}
voidinput(structStudentstu[],intn){
inti;
printf("请输入各学生的信息:学号、姓名、成绩: ");
for(i=0;i<n;i++)
scanf("%d%s%d",&stu[i].num,stu[i].name,&stu[i].grade);
}
voidorder(structStudentstu[],intn){
inti,j;
structStudenttemp;
for(i=0;i<n-1;i++){
for(j=i+1;j<n;j++){
if(stu[i].grade<stu[j].grade){
temp=stu[i];
stu[i]=stu[j];
stu[j]=temp;
}
}
}
}
intsum(structStudentstu[],intn){
inti,sum=0;
for(i=0;i<n;++i)
sum+=stu[i].grade;
returnsum;
}
⑶ 一、学生信息管理系统中的student(学生信息表)和s_course(学生成绩表)结构如下,请根据表回答问题:
给你具体做了一下:
第一题:
1.【创建表】
Create table student
(
S_no char(6) PRIMARY KEY,
S_name varchar(30) NOTNULL,
S_department varchar(50) NOT NULL,
)
2.【根据参照完整性来回答】
一般先录入student表中的数据,因为course表中的S_no是外键,是参照了student表中的s_no列,所以先录入student数据
3.【添加记录,数据的更新】
Insert
Into student (s_no,s_name,s_Department)
Values(‘090101’,’ 袁俊芳’,’ 信息工程系’)
4.【主键】
主键,即主码,使表中在这一列取值唯一,也就是student表中的学号s_no这一列不能有重复值
第二题:因为这个题目没有列名什么的,我也没环境看到,所以就把带列名的用括号注明了,lz用的时候直接查出,放在里面就可以了
1.【更新表】
Update Goods
Set (表状态的列名)=’热点’
Where (商品名)=’ 三星C178’
2.【创建试图】
Create view H_Goods
As
Selete *
From Goods
Where (类别号)=’01’ //我不知道需不需要建立连接了,先不建了,下题建
3.【查询语句】
Selete 商品号,商品名称,商品类别号,商品类别
From Goods, Types
Where Goods.商品号=Types.商品号 AND
类别号='02'
//此处建立了连接
希望可以帮助你o(∩_∩)o
⑷ excel学生成绩表
自动筛选,成绩下选自定义,输入小于60筛选后把第一个小于60的数改为红颜色的“不及格”然后复制,选中其余的数值粘贴就可以了。
⑸ excel怎么把学生成绩表录入到学籍信息表
学籍系统一般有成绩表导入的入口,大多提供学生成绩表录入模板,你只要找到并根据模板上的条目完善补充就可以了,然后从导入入口把完善好的数据表导入即可。
⑹ 小学生信息表科目成绩怎么填写
逻辑上,分3步。使用子查询:
--3,针对这些人,求平均分
SELECTid
,AVG(Score)
FROMStudent
WHEREidIN(
--2,找到非'不及格'的学生
SELECTid
FROMStudent
WHEREidNOTIN(
--1,成绩不及格的学生
SELECTDISTINCTid
FROMStudent
WHEREScore<60
)
GROUPBYid